diff --git a/lib/providers/apps_provider.dart b/lib/providers/apps_provider.dart index c10d401..e61c89a 100644 --- a/lib/providers/apps_provider.dart +++ b/lib/providers/apps_provider.dart @@ -1084,7 +1084,8 @@ class AppsProvider with ChangeNotifier { var trackOnly = apps[id]!.app.additionalSettings['trackOnly'] == true; var refreshBeforeDownload = apps[id]!.app.additionalSettings['refreshBeforeDownload'] == true || - apps[id]!.app.apkUrls.first.value == 'placeholder'; + apps[id]!.app.apkUrls.isNotEmpty && + apps[id]!.app.apkUrls.first.value == 'placeholder'; if (refreshBeforeDownload) { await checkUpdate(apps[id]!.app.id); }